Controlled
anger served its client well
John (not his real name) was
employed as an accountant in a busy finance and investment
company and he enjoyed the challenges of his job, in fact he
took great pleasure in it. His working
relationships with clients, management and other workers was fine.
His family and social life was stable and enjoyable. Life
was good.
A change in management saw
John become more short tempered with other colleagues.
His family and social life were being consumed by
aggravating stories
about this work. Soon his family and social life
suffered and friends started to drop off. After a
while John seemed to think the whole world was against
him. He became snappy, work colleagues avoided him and
he wasn't invited out to parties and barbeques as he once
was. The relationships he was having with others
suffered. He was feeling quite
depressed from time to time. He had put on weight
and his blood pressure was up.
Individual anger management sessions
helped John with his problem. John's perceptions of
the world changed and he now enjoys his work
more, work colleagues are talking to him again and he is catching up with friends and his family life has
improved. Why? John learned not to avoid his
anger, handle his distrust-based anger and realised that he
was very much in control of work, family and social
commitments.
This short
story demonstrates that anger can effect many areas of our
lives - work, family, social and health!
Identifying
the various types of anger together with an appropriate
treatment methodology is essential.
The positive side of effective
anger management is improved relationships at home, work and play. This has a positive effect on a
person's self-esteem which feeds positively back into the
person's life. Oh, by the way, he no longer feels
depressed, his blood pressure and weight are down and he is
working toward a pay rise and promotion.
